Marshall County Little League Basketball All-Star Games to be held Monday, Tuesday

BENTON, KY (February 1, 2017) — The best of 168 Marshall County 3rd through 5th grade basketball players will take the court for their final game of the season Monday at North Marshall Middle School and Tuesday at South Marshall Middle School in the annual Marshall County Little League All-Star Showcase.

Coaches cast their All-Star votes after each game throughout the regular season, and players received bonus votes based on their team’s record. Those players with the most votes in each age group were selected for the All-Star teams. Adding to the excitement, the 5th-grade boys’ All-Star teams will be coached by middle school coaches Eli Lathram from North Marshall and Cole Nelson and Chase Buchanan from South. North Marshall’s Mariah Wilson and South’s Doug Lyles will coach the 5th-grade girls’ teams.

Game Schedule:

Monday, Feb. 6 North Marshall Middle School

  • 5:30 p.m. 3rd/4th-grade Girls
  • 6:45 p.m. 3rd-grade Boys
  • 8 p.m. 4th-grade Boys

Tuesday, Feb. 7 South Marshall Middle School

  • 6 p.m. 5th-grade Girls
  • 7:15 p.m. 5th-grade Boys

Our motto is ‘Little things make big things happen,’ and based on the growth we’ve seen in all the players, we’ve accomplished some big things,” said Dave Washburn, Marshall County Little League Basketball president. “We hope the community will come out and watch the games Monday and Tuesday to show their support for the future of Marshall County basketball.” 

Admission to the games is $3 for adults & $2 for students. Marshall County Little League players who wear their 2016-2017 Marshall County Little League t-shirt receive free admission as do all the All-Star players and volunteer coaches. Proceeds benefit the North Marshall and South Marshall middle school basketball programs and Marshall County Little League Basketball.

Marshall County Little League cheer squads will perform and be recognized at each game.

“Marshall County is fortunate to have a dedicated group of volunteer coaches and parents who support athletics during these important formative years,” Washburn said.
